SWR TO RUN SPECIAL TRAINS FOR CHHATH PUJA

more... Western Railway has decided to run Chhath Puja Special trains to facilitate passengers during festive rush. The details of dates, timings and stoppages are as mentioned below: -: -
ØTrain No. 06549/06550 Yesvantpur - Danapur - Yesvantpur Weekly Special Express (Two trips): -
Train No. 06549 Yesvantpur - Danapur Special Express will leave Yesvantpur at 08:00 AM on 29.10.2022 & 05.11.2022 (Saturday) and reach Danapur at 08:00 AM on the third day (Monday). The train will have stoppages at Yelahanka (08:18/08:20 am), Hindupur (09:38/09:40 am), Dharmavaram (11:15/11:20 am), Anantapur (12:28/12:30 pm), Guntakal (01:45/01:50 pm), Manthralayam Road (03:19/03:20 pm), Raichur (03:48/03:50 pm), Seram (05:48/05:50 pm), Vikarabad (07:50/07:55 pm), Lingampalli (08:35/08:37 pm), Secunderabad (09:20/09:30 pm), Kazipet (11:18/11:20 pm), Manchiryal (01:00/01:02 am), Sirpur Kaghaznagar (02:20/02:22 am), Balharshah (03:55/04:00 am), Nagpur (07:25/07:30 am), Itarsi (01:35/01:45 pm), Jabalpur (04:40/04:50 pm), Satna (07:35/07:45 pm), Prayagraj Jn. (01:25/01:55 am), Banaras (04:15/04:20 am), Varanasi (04:25/04:27 am), Pt.Deen Dayal Upadhyaya Jn. (05:00/05:10 am) and Ara Jn. (07:05/07:07 am) stations.
In the return direction, Train No. 06550 Danapur – Yesvantpur Special Express will leave Danapur at 05:10 PM on 31.10.2022 & 07.11.2022 (Monday) and reach Yesvantpur at 01:30 PM on the third day (Wednesday). The train will have stoppages at Ara Jn. (05:39/05:41 pm), Pt.Deen Dayal Upadhyaya Jn. (08:04/08:14 pm), Varanasi (08:34/08:36 pm), Banaras (08:40/08:45 pm), Prayagraj Jn. (11:15/11:35 pm), Satna (03:00/03:10 am), Jabalpur (06:00/06:10 am), Itarsi (10:35/10:45 am), Nagpur (04:05/04:10 pm), Balharshah (07:55/08:00 pm), Sirpur Kaghaznagar (08:50/08:52 pm), Manchiryal (09:40/09:42 pm), Kazipet (11:13/11:15 pm), Secunderabad (01:00/01:10 am), Lingampalli (01:38/01:40 am), Vikarabad (02:18/02:20 am), Seram (03:58/04:00 am), Raichur (06:30/06:32 am), Manthralayam Road (06:50/06:52 am), Guntakal (08:30/08:35 am), Anantapur (10:00/10:02 am), Dharmavaram (10:13/10:15 am), Hindupur (11:04/11:06 am) and Yelahanka (12:50/12:52 pm) stations.
These trains will have a total of twenty coaches comprising one AC Two tier, Eight AC Three tier, Nine Sleeper Class and Two Luggage cum Brake-Vans with Generator Cars.
